免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5网站做成app

随着智能手机的普及和移动互联网的发展,越来越多的企业和个人开始关注把自己的网站转换成移动端的应用程序。而HTML5作为当前最流行的Web开发技术之一,已经拥有许多成熟的框架和工具,方便将H5网站转换为应用程序。本篇文章主要介绍将H5网站制作成App的原理和常见的制作方法。

一. 制作原理

1. Native App

Native App指的是原生应用,在某个具体的移动设备操作系统平台上使用原生API编程的应用程序。Native App可以利用设备的许多硬件和软件功能,如相机、加速度计和通知中心等。

因此,如果想把H5页面制作成Native App,需要使用相关的开发工具和语言,例如Xcode开发工具、Swift和Objective-C语言等。这种方法制作的应用具有更好的稳定性和性能,但需要更多的开发成本。

2. Hybrid App

Hybrid App指的是混合应用,它是Native App和Web App的结合体。Hybrid App主要使用Web技术,如HTML5、CSS和JavaScript等,通过Native App提供的WebView组件来运行。

在Hybrid App里,Native代码主要负责容器的搭建和基础功能的实现,而Web代码负责渲染和动态内容的更新。Hybrid App的开发相对简单,但是性能和稳定性相对Native App来说还有一些差距。

3. Web App

Web App是网页应用程序,通过浏览器来访问。Web App可以运行在具有浏览器的任何设备上,包括桌面电脑和移动设备。Web App拥有最好的跨平台性和开发效率,但访问速度和有限的设备接口可能会受到限制。

二. 制作方法

1. 使用Web App Maker

Web App Maker是一种直接将H5网站转换为Web App的工具,无需通过Native App的开发过程。这种方法的优点是可节省大量开发成本,但也存在一些限制,比如应用程序不能调用设备的硬件功能。

目前比较流行的Web App Maker有:

- APPmaker:该工具提供一个简单的界面来创建应用,并提供不同的主题和应用样式。

- Mobincube:该工具允许用户轻松添加元素、功能和媒体文件。通过Mobincube,用户可以创建许多不同类型的应用程序,包括社交网络和游戏等。

2. 使用Hybrid App框架

Hybrid App框架可以帮助开发者快速创建一个基于H5网站的混合应用程序。这种方法需要选择适合网站的框架,并进行配置和适配工作。目前比较流行的Hybrid App框架有:

- Ionic:该框架是目前最流行的Hybrid App框架之一,它允许开发者使用AngularJS和HTML来构建应用程序。Ionic提供了各种组件和样式,可以轻松创建各种类型的应用程序。

- PhoneGap:该框架基于Apache Cordova项目构建,提供了访问本地设备功能的API。开发者可以使用HTML、CSS和JavaScript来构建应用程序,并在不同平台上运行它们。

3. 自主开发Native App

自主开发Native App需要更多的开发成本和精力,但是它能够提供更好的性能和更深入地访问设备功能。这种方法需要学习各种移动应用程序开发技术和API,并使用相关的开发工具进行开发。目前比较流行的开发工具有:

- Xcode:Xcode是苹果公司的集成开发环境,可以用于创建iOS应用程序。

- Android Studio:Android Studio是谷歌提供的Android开发工具,可以用于创建Android应用程序。

本文简单介绍了将H5网站制作成App的原理和常见的制作方法。在选择具体的制作方法时,需要根据实际情况进行综合权衡,选择适合自己的方式。无论哪种方法,都需要对Web技术有深入的了解和掌握,才能更好地实现H5网站转换为App的目标。


相关知识:
做网站难还是做app难
这个问题无法从根本上回答,因为“做网站难还是做APP难”的答案取决于您关心哪些方面。以下是一些有关网站和APP开发的相关信息,以帮助你作出更明智的决策。网站开发:在开发网站时,需要考虑很多方面。首先是选择开发平台。现在主流的网站开发平台有WordPress
2023-05-18
做一款app和网站要多少钱
做一款app和网站的费用因项目规模、开发难度、技术选型、选用服务商等多种因素影响,费用也因此有很大的差异。下面是一些可能影响费用的因素:1. 功能需求:不同的功能和交互方式会导致不同的开发难度和时间成本,进而影响价钱。一般而言,简单的app可能需要5万人民
2023-05-18
网站做成的app怎么更改域名
如果你已经在网站上搭建了一个应用程序,比如说一个在线商店应用,然后你决定为它创建一个适用于iOS和Android的应用程序。假设你自己没有开发移动应用程序的技能,那么一种解决方案是将你的网站应用程序转化为一个移动应用程序。这个过程需要使用特定的软件工具,比
2023-05-18
前端工程师是做app的吗
前端工程师是负责开发网页、网站、移动应用等交互界面的开发工具人员,这些应用可以运行在Windows、Android、iOS等平台上,现在前端工程师是近年来互联网领域非常热门的职业,越来越多的企业需要前端工程师的帮助,让用户更好地使用他们的应用程序。就APP
2023-05-18
前端做一个app的流程
要做一个app,前端开发的流程大体上分为以下几步:1. 前期准备工作在开发app前,需要明确app的功能以及面向的用户。同时,还需要选定对应平台的开发环境和工具,如Android Studio、Xcode等。2. 设计app的UI和交互在设计UI和交互时,
2023-05-18
公司做网站app入什么科目
公司开发网站和App是一项复杂的任务,需要掌握多种科目。以下是关键科目的详细介绍。1. HTML/CSS/JavaScriptHTML(超文本标记语言)、CSS(层叠样式表)和JavaScript是网站开发的基本组件。 HTML 是用来定义网页结构的语言,
2023-05-18
个人开发者做网站还是app比较好
作为个人开发者,要选择做网站还是App需要根据自己的具体情况来决定。首先,我们需要考虑自己的专业能力和技术水平。如果你擅长Web开发,理解Web应用和服务端的工作原理及技术,那么做网站可能会更适合你。如果你比较熟悉移动端开发技术,或者你的应用更需要与移动设
2023-05-18
vue做app登录信息
Vue.js 是一个渐进式 JavaScript 框架,它为开发单页面应用程序提供了一种响应式和组件化的方式。Vue.js 通过使用虚拟 DOM 和模板语法,使开发者更加容易构建用户界面。在实现 App 登录信息的时候,Vue.js 可以通过以下方式进行处
2023-05-18
php做app选什么
在选择用PHP构建移动应用程序时,我们需要考虑到许多方面。首先必须了解的是PHP并不是最常用的移动应用程序开发语言,常见的是Java、Swift、Kotlin、React Native等。尽管如此,使用PHP来构建移动应用程序也具备优点:PHP是一种开放源
2023-05-18
htmlcssjs做个app
HTML、CSS 和 JavaScript 是开发 Web 应用 或网站的三个核心技术。很多人也会用他们来做跨平台 App 的开发,因为这个技术堆栈简单,易学易用,而且可以在多个平台上运行。本文将会探讨如何使用 HTML、CSS 和 JavaScript
2023-05-18
app前端工程师做什么
App前端工程师是移动开发领域中的一种工作职位,主要负责开发手机应用的前端部分。app前端工程师需要掌握各种移动开发技术,并且要有良好的视觉设计能力和编程技能。在开发过程中,app前端工程师需要负责以下事项:1. 界面设计:通过熟练掌握移动UI设计原则和常
2023-05-18
扫一扫功能操作详解
扫一扫功能操作详解扫一扫是唤起设备相机,对二维码或者条形码完成扫码,之后由APP处理扫码结果或将扫码数据交由指定网址处理。1.在配置APP里面找到【扫一扫】功能2.点击功能图标,弹出配置界面温馨提示:扫一扫功能可以在【原生标题栏】里面直接显示按钮,开启即可
2019-03-01
©2015-2021 智电瑞创 蜀ICP备17039183号